About The Position

The Finance Manager is responsible for assisting the finance team in the detailed financial analysis of EyeCare Partners healthcare operations. This role reports directly to the Director of Operational Finance, and partners closely with the Ophthalmology Operations leadership teams to drive operational improvements and efficiencies. The ideal candidate will be detail oriented with a focus on growth, margin and profitability goals and contribute as a valued member of the team. The Finance Manager develops, executes, and analyzes financial reports/models that aid in the decision making of the company. This strategic role will be responsible for the effective interpretation of financial information to identify key issues and strategies that support the company’s operational plan. Provide substantially improved and actionable recommendations to strategically enhance financial performance and business opportunities.

Requirements

  • 5+ years management consulting, corporate strategy, financial analysis
  • 5+ years experience in financial planning, financial modeling, and creating data-driven analyses
  • Experience supporting operations in a multi-site healthcare or clinic-based organization.
  • Ability to analyze large, complex data to uncover insights and support strategic decisions.
  • Identifying business and operational risks and implementing effective mitigation strategies.
  • Ability to build consensus and influence cross-functional stakeholders to solve complex business challenges through data-driven decision-making.
  • Strong prioritization, planning, and time management skills with the ability to meet deadlines and execute effectively despite ambiguity.
  • Experience managing and developing team members, including delegating work effectively, providing regular coaching and feedback, and supporting direct reports' professional growth
  • BS Degree in Accounting, Finance, or Business Administration

Nice To Haves

  • Advanced degree preferred (MBA, MSA, or other equivalent advanced degree in Finance, Accounting, or Business)
  • SAP, Adaptive Planning, or PowerBI experience a big plus
  • SQL knowledge a plus; ability to query and manipulate large datasets from underlying systems to support financial analysis and reporting

Responsibilities

  • Lead the budgeting process with practice leadership and drive execution against financial plans.
  • Prepare, analyze, consolidate, and communicate actual, forecast, and budget results to leadership on a monthly and mid-month basis
  • Partner with financial and operational leaders to identify issues, analyze data, and provide actionable insights.
  • Develop financial models, reports, and analyses using Excel and financial planning tools.
  • Evaluate capital investment opportunities and calculate ROI for real estate projects. (de novo or relocation projects)
  • Maintain forecasts and predictive models to support business planning and performance management.
  • Present financial results, variance analyses, and recommendations during monthly business reviews.
  • Support strategic decision-making through financial analysis and cross-functional collaboration.
  • Adapt to changing business needs while managing special projects and ad hoc analyses.
  • Travel as needed to meet with division leadership and participate in business review meetings.
